The Island of Paros: excursions

As the center of the Cycladic sea routes that can be utilized as the starting point for trips to neighboring Grecian islands, Paros is the place to go whether you're a vacationer who wishes to have a luxury cruise across the tourist spot or an independent traveler who wants to start his island-hopping off with a bang. At any rate, here are some of the trips on offer by Paros:

Santorini: With villages perched atop scenic cliffs and peaceful beaches down below, Santorini aims to reach for the heavens to give you a piece of paradise here on Earth.

Delos to Mykonos: You can't go wrong with a trip to the ever-famous Delos, the supposed Mecca of the Ancient Greeks that's filled with unique ancient monuments, and a journey to the popular Mykonos, with its cosmopolitan sensibilities and its magnificent Cycladic architecture.

The Cyclades: Unblemished by the ravages of modern time, the way of life in these islands are at least ten years behind the rest of the world.

Antiparos: Accessible by taxi ferries from Pounta or small boats from Parikia, this peaceful island is home to a internationally renowned cave and the ever-present world-class beaches.

Naxos: Its Venetian castle, huge beaches, and a fascinating inland area make Naxos a place to be for avid sightseers everywhere.

Amorgos: This is an island that provides vacationers with both a spiritual encounter and physical respite. The Monastery of Hozoviotisa, which was built against the side of a vertical rock, and the medieval capital of Amorgos, which is also of great historical interest, are two great reasons to have an excursion to this island.

Tinos: Famous for Panavia, a marble-constructed church, and its miraculous icon, Tinos makes any visit to it a truly worthwhile—if not altogether religious—experience.
